Subject: Firmware channel cutover — Ledgepine devices

Hi all — as our new contractor, please note the stable firmware channel now requires signed manifests before promotion. Unsigned builds land in the sandbox channel only. Do not promote anything manually this week; the pipeline handles it. The current candidate is identified by the token below.

session token of bawep-yadup = htk21_528abd376e3c5a4ec24a1

Handover Note — Director Transition

To the board: I am passing oversight of the Corvalane term sheet to Director Mellows. Key open items are the exclusivity clause and the milestone schedule, both flagged by counsel. Please review the attached redlines before Thursday. The confidential summary of our plans follows below.

confidential, bafof-bawip: Sordorox Logistics is in early talks to buy Sorixox Systems for about $17.6 million. The Jorox launch date is January 3, and nothing goes to the press before then.

## Who to contact — RateLens

RateLens checks hotel rate parity across partner channels. Do not ping individuals directly. Config changes: file a ticket in the RateLens queue. Data feed gaps: the ingestion rotation owns those. Scraper bans or partner complaints: partnerships team only. Anything ambiguous, or access requests during your first week, goes to this address.

billing contact of yawip-yadup = druath.casdor@nelvrolabs.internal

## Deploying the Gatewick Proctor Queue

Deploys are pretty painless: push to main, wait for the pipeline, then watch the queue drain dashboard for five minutes. If candidates pile up mid-exam, roll back first and ask questions later — the queue replays safely. Everything the workers care about lives in one config block, shown here for reference.

settings of bafof-yagef:
JOROX_PIN=8740
JOROX_TENANT=pelox
JOROX_METRICS_HOST=metrics.jorox.qorvelworks.internal
JOROX_SEAL=seal_c78f63c1
JOROX_STANDBY_TEAM=norax